#include "lib_tty.hpp"
#include "interaction_result.h"
#include "global_entities.h"
#include "state_menu.h"
#include "menu.h"
#include "menu_option.h"
#include "process_menu.h"
#include "menu_actions.h"
#include "window_panel.h"
#include <iostream>
#include <cassert>
/// Loop until we return a menu_selection selected by the user from the menu_options that were prompted.
/// TODO: allow arrow keys to select? or allow a number representing the entry to be selected??
Menu_option const &
input_menu_selection( State_menu & state_menu, std::shared_ptr<Menu> const menu_sp ) {
assert( menu_sp && "Precondition." ); // TODO??: is this the correct check?
//assert( state_menu && "Precondition." ); // TODO??: is this the correct check?
while (true) {
auto r = pagination( state_menu, {.height= 1, .width= menu_sp->name.length() + 3 + 1} ); // +1 for cursor position. // TODO: complete this above.
cout << menu_sp->name<<">> "; cout.flush();
pagination_reset( state_menu, {0,0});
auto const [key_char_i18ns, hot_key_row, file_status] { Lib_tty::get_kb_keystrokes_raw( 1, false, true, true )};
// *** handle file_status *** // TODO: this
// *** handle Hot_key_rows *** // WARNING NOTE: TODO: improve this! Here we link the hot_key_row to the regular key for getting "help", ie. F1 key. The mapping is found in lib_tty::consider_Hot_key_row()::Hot_key_rows.
Lib_tty::Key_chars_i18n user_menu_selection { (hot_key_row.function_cat == Lib_tty::HotKeyFunctionCat::help_popup || (key_char_i18ns.at(0) == '?')) ? Lib_tty::Key_chars_i18n {'h'} : key_char_i18ns }; // TODO: h and ? are magic numbers.
// *** handle actual selection ***
for ( Menu_option const & menu_option: menu_sp->options ) {
assert( user_menu_selection.size() == 1 && "Logic error: currenlty only single char menu selections are allowed.");
if ( user_menu_selection.at(0) == menu_option.input_token[0] ) { // TODO: only allows for length 1 one menu selections as shown 5 lines up.
cout << endl; // We finish our prompt and user input sucessfully.
assert( menu_option.name != STRING_NULL && "Precondition." );
return menu_option; //RR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RRR
}
}
cout << "\aInvalid menu selection or key press, try again, or press the single <h> key for (h)elp." << endl;
}
assert(false && "We should never get here."); // infinute loop that is exited via a menu selection. Should never get here, obviously not needed, but placed here for clarity. TODO: fix this up.
}
// The 'Overloaded' pattern _could_ have been standardized in c++20 but wasn't, as per Stroustup in A Tour of C++ 2nd Edition, Page 176.
template<class... Ts> // variadic ie. any number of any type are handled. Below we use several in the contructor of our one object. // ... is a parameter pack.
struct Overloaded : Ts... { // inherit from all those types TODO: how does this work??
using Ts::operator()...; // all of those operator()s. // new in c++17.
};
template<class... Ts>
Overloaded(Ts...) -> Overloaded<Ts...>; // deduction guide. -> = returns. TODO: explain: what returns what to whom??
InteractionResult const process_menu_selection( State_menu & state, Menu_option const & menu_selection ) { /// run the menu action
// get some general data, even though it is not used for every overload.
std::shared_ptr<Menu> current_menu_sp { state.menu_top_sp() }; // TODO: I don't think I need a value in the lambda, because it is overridden at std::visit?
Menu current_menu { *current_menu_sp };
State_menu kludge_state {};
/* Some prior development ideas preserved for understanding of the history
//Menu kludge_menu {};
// std::shared_ptr<Menu> kludge_menu_sp {};
// IO_table kludge_table {}; // state.io_table_sp(); // TODO: I don't think I need a value in the lambda, because it is overridden at std::visit?A
// IO_row_variant kludge_row_var {};
// Row_range kludge_row_range {};
// size_t kludge_row_index {};
// std::filesystem::path kludge_file_path {};
// if ( std::get<>(menu_selection.menu_action_fn) != nullptr) {
// auto r = std::get<std::function<Action_post_return_struct(State&)>>(menu_selection.menu_action_fn_variant)(state);
*/
auto function_object_overload_set = Overloaded {
[&kludge_state ] ( std::function< InteractionResult(State_menu & ) > &af)
{ auto r = af( kludge_state );
//LOGGER_(" ");LOGGER_( "[] state overload.");
return r;
}, // to be invoked via operator() on the function object (AKA lambda) or any callable object.
[&kludge_state, ¤t_menu] ( std::function< InteractionResult(State_menu &, Menu const &) > &af)
{ auto r = af( kludge_state, current_menu );
LOGGER_(" ");LOGGER_("[] state,menu overload.");
return r;
}, // to be invoked via operator() on the function object (AKA lambda) or any callable object.
/* Some prior development ideas preserved for understanding of the history
//[] (std::function<InteractionResult()> &af) { auto r = af(); cerr<<"\nvoid overload.\n"; return r; }, // to be invoked via operator() on the function object (AKA lambda) or any callable object.
//[&kludge_state, &kludge_menu_sp] (std::function<InteractionResult(State_menu &, std::shared_ptr<Menu>)> &af) { auto r = af( kludge_state, kludge_menu_sp ); cerr<<"\nmenu_sp overload.\n"; return r; }, // to be invoked via operator() on the function object (AKA lambda) or any callable object.
//[&kludge_state, &kludge_table] (std::function<InteractionResult(State_menu &, IO_table &)> &af) { auto r = af( kludge_state, kludge_table );cerr<<"\ntable overload.\n"; return r; }, // to be invoked via operator() on the function object (AKA lambda) or any callable object.
//[&kludge_state, &kludge_table] (std::function<InteractionResult(State_menu &, IO_table const &)> &af) { auto r = af( kludge_state, kludge_table );cerr<<"\ntable overload.\n"; return r; }, // to be invoked via operator() on the function object (AKA lambda) or any callable object.
//[&state ] (std::function<decltype(action_program_exit_with_prompts)> &af) { auto r = af(state); return r; }, // to be invoked via operator() on the function object (AKA lambda) or any callable object.
//[&state, &menu] (std::function<decltype(action_print_menu)> &af) { auto r = af(state,menu); return r; }, // NOTE: each of these must also appear in Menu_action_fn_variant type!
//[&state, &menu_sp] (std::function<decltype(process_menu)> &af) { auto r = af(state,menu_sp); return r; },
//[&state, &kludge_table] (std::function<decltype(action_io_row_create)> &af) { auto r = af(state,kludge_table); return r; },
//[&state, &kludge_row_var] (std::function<decltype(action_io_row_print)> &af) { auto r = af(state,kludge_row_var); return r; },
//[&state, &kludge_table, &kludge_row_index] (std::function<decltype(action_io_row_print_index)> &af) { auto r = af(state,kludge_table,kludge_row_index); return r; },
//[&state, &kludge_table, &kludge_row_range] (std::function<decltype(action_io_row_list_rows)> &af) { auto r = af(state,kludge_table,kludge_row_range); return r; },
//[&state, &kludge_file_path] (std::function<decltype(action_save_as_changes_to_disk)> &af) { auto r = af(state,kludge_file_path); return r; }
*/
};
auto fo_return_type_overloaded_set = [ & ] (auto... args) -> InteractionResult
{ return function_object_overload_set( args...); }; // not needed if all return types are the same, which is the current case and that is used in the return type of this function.
InteractionResult action_result = std::visit( fo_return_type_overloaded_set, menu_selection.menu_action_fn_variant );
return action_result;
// some history: } else // return menu_selection.option_value; TODO: this may or may not be applicable depending on the use of menus to select values to be used by other? functions.
}
InteractionResult const
process_menu( State_menu & state, // needed for menu and application, like a global variable/singleton. TODO: improve this?
std::shared_ptr<Menu> menu_sp ) { // the menu we will run/process
assert( menu_sp != nullptr && "We must have a menu to process");
state.push_menu_sp( menu_sp ); // our currently active menu is stored at top of stack
while (true) { /* input menu selection and run it */
Menu_option const menu_option { input_menu_selection( state, menu_sp )};
InteractionResult const ir { process_menu_selection( state, menu_option )};
switch ( ir.navigation ) { // post processing: load the correct menu to be shown to user, or exit.
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::retain_menu: // we did something on this menu and we stay on current menu and just loop.
break;
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::prior_menu: // we have been asked to go back one level of menu so we get and set that menu, and loop.
menu_sp = state.menu_pop_top_sp();
break;
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::main_menu: // we have been asked to go directly to main menu so we set that menu and loop.
menu_sp = state.menu_pop_to_sp(state.getMenu_main());
break;
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::exit_all_menu: // we have been asked to go directly to main menu so we set that menu and loop.
return { {}, {}, {}, {},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::exit_all_menu }; // returning to main to get out. return result is probably not needed?
// *** above are valid return values from running an "action_", *** below are simply debugging code.
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::exit_pgm_immediately:
// return { {}, {}, {}, {}, InteractionResultNav::exit_pgm_immediately }; // returning to main to get out. return result is probably not needed?
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::exit_pgm_with_prompts:
// return { {}, {}, {}, {}, InteractionResultNav::exit_pgm_with_prompts }; // returning to main to get out. return result is probably not needed?
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::continue_forward_pagination: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::continue_backward_pagination: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::exit_fn_immediately: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::exit_fn_with_prompts: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::prior_menu_discard_value: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::up_one_field: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::down_one_field: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::up_one_block: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::down_one_block: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::save_form_as_is: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::skip_one_field: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::skip_to_end_of_fields: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::next_row: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::prior_row: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::first_row: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::last_row: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::na:
case Lib_tty::InteractionIntentNav::no_result : // TODO: correct?
// TODO assert(( "Logic error: process_menu: invalid InteractionResultNav after doing menu selection.", false));
break;
}
}
}
InteractionResult const process_main_menu(State_menu & state ) { // cannot overload process_menu, or Overload become ambiguous. TODO??: Is there a fix/cast?
action_print_menu_help( state, *state.getMenu_main());
return process_menu( state, state.getMenu_main());
}
